Transplant Cardiology Post-Transplant Care

In the realm of transplant cardiology, post-transplant care is a critical phase that requires meticulous attention to detail to ensure the long-term survival and well-being of the patient. This phase is characterized by a complex interplay of immunosuppressive regimens, monitoring for potential complications, and management of comorbidities. The primary goal of post-transplant care is to prevent rejection of the transplanted heart, manage side effects of immunosuppressive medications, and promote recovery and rehabilitation of the patient.

One of the key concepts in post-transplant care is the immunosuppressive regimen, which is designed to prevent the immune system from rejecting the transplanted heart. This regimen typically consists of a combination of medications, including corticosteroids, calcineurin inhibitors, and antiproliferative agents. The choice of immunosuppressive regimen is individualized based on the patient's risk profile, renal function, and comorbidities. For example, patients with renal dysfunction may require a reduced dose of calcineurin inhibitors to minimize the risk of nephrotoxicity.

Another crucial aspect of post-transplant care is monitoring for potential complications, including infection, rejection, and malignancy. Patients are typically monitored closely for signs and symptoms of infection, such as fever, leukocytosis, and positive cultures. Rejection is monitored through regular endomyocardial biopsies, which involve obtaining a tissue sample from the transplanted heart to assess for inflammation and fibrosis. Patients are also screened regularly for malignancy, including skin cancer and lymphoma, which are more common in immunosuppressed patients.

The management of comorbidities is also a critical component of post-transplant care. Patients with a history of hypertension or diabetes mellitus require close monitoring and management of these conditions to prevent cardiovascular complications. For example, patients with hypertension may require titration of their antihypertensive medications to achieve optimal blood pressure control. Patients with diabetes mellitus may require adjustments to their insulin regimen or oral hypoglycemic medications to maintain optimal glucose control.

In addition to medical management, post-transplant care also involves lifestyle modifications to promote recovery and rehabilitation. Patients are typically encouraged to engage in regular exercise, such as walking or swimming, to improve cardiovascular fitness and reduce stress. Patients are also counseled on the importance of smoking cessation and avoidance of substance abuse to prevent cardiovascular complications.

The psychological aspects of post-transplant care are also critical, as patients may experience anxiety, depression, and post-traumatic stress disorder (PTSD) following transplantation. Patients are typically screened for psychological distress and referenced to mental health professionals for counseling and support. For example, patients may benefit from cognitive-behavioral therapy (CBT) to manage anxiety and depression, or support groups to connect with other patients who have undergone transplantation.

The coordination of post-transplant care is also essential, as patients require close follow-up with their transplant team, including cardiologists, surgeons, and nurses. Patients are typically seen regularly in the outpatient clinic for monitoring and management of their condition, and may require hospitalization for complications or adjustments to their immunosuppressive regimen. The communication between the transplant team and the patient's primary care physician is also critical, as patients may require ongoing care for comorbidities and other medical conditions.
